So I had been really in-love with one of Lulu's dresses and had to wait for it to come back in stock. Even with the dress being 80 USD (around 108 CAD) I still wanted to buy them. I had read plenty of reviews on the dress but was unsure of what size to get. So I decided to go with buying both a small and medium. I didn't even think twice about looking at the return policy, as I remember seeing a 10 day free-return policy.! I found out after both dresses arrived however, that the 10 day free-shipping was for United States residence only. I also discovered that if you're a Canadian buyer, you'll have to pay the return postage (20-30$ CAD) and then also pay the return duties and taxes (about 60 CAD) so, for me to return the dress I would almost be paying for a brand new dress! Ridiculous! It's not worth it to return! So it'll remain in the plastic sleeve that they sent to me in my closetsuch a waste.

I was also deeply disappointed with the quality of the dress; for 108CAD I was expecting a material that doesn't wrinkle whenever you sit on it. After ironing it for 10 minutes, I noticed that there were even loose strings! I know it's not that big of a deal, and I can cut the strings off, however for paying 108 CAD, I would expect a more expensive material to be chosen so the dress would not wrinkle, and not have any loose strings! Now I'm worried that the loose strings may unthread. Really disappointed.

I was shocked to discover when the package arrived the tax and duties were almost 60 CAD! While I know this is the Canadian Government that implements these tax and duties, I am still so shocked. I have bought tonnes of stuff from Japan, Korea and even China and have never been once dinged for duties! Some brands already cover tax and duties for Canadian customers (Aerie, Urban Outfitters). I would strongly suggest international customers that if you want to buy items from Lulu's to read the fine print.

I guess the most upsetting thing is the lack of support for international buyers. To fellow Canadians: it is not worth buying from this brand; the quality does not match the price and you will just be disappointed. If you want to return an item you'll be expected to pay both the return postage and the return tax and duties. I will not be buying from Lulu's again. Severely disappointed with the quality of the dress, the lack of support and services available for Canadian customers.
